Skip to content

chore: remove portia integration example#57

Open
Kylejeong2 wants to merge 1 commit intomainfrom
chore/remove-portia-integration
Open

chore: remove portia integration example#57
Kylejeong2 wants to merge 1 commit intomainfrom
chore/remove-portia-integration

Conversation

@Kylejeong2
Copy link
Copy Markdown
Member

Summary

  • Remove examples/integrations/portia
  • Drop Portia section and duplicate stripe tree line from README

Made with Cursor

- Remove examples/integrations/portia
- Drop Portia section and duplicate stripe tree line from README

Made-with: Cursor
@claude
Copy link
Copy Markdown

claude bot commented Mar 30, 2026

Claude finished @Kylejeong2's task —— View job


PR Review Complete ✅

Todo List:

  • Read the changed files to understand what was removed
  • Check README changes for completeness
  • Search for any remaining Portia references that might have been missed
  • Provide comprehensive review feedback

Review Feedback

This is a clean and well-executed removal of the Portia integration example. Here's my analysis:

Code Quality & Best Practices

  • Excellent cleanup: All Portia-related files have been completely removed
  • Consistent commit message: Follows conventional commit format with clear description
  • Complete removal: All 7 files from examples/integrations/portia/ directory have been properly deleted
  • README properly updated: Portia section removed from the integration list

Completeness Check

  • No orphaned references: Searched the entire codebase and found no remaining references to "portia"
  • README structure maintained: The document structure and formatting remain consistent
  • Monorepo structure updated: The file tree in the README correctly excludes the removed directory

Potential Issues

  • None identified: This is a straightforward removal with no apparent issues
  • Safe deletion: Since this was an example integration, removing it poses no risk to core functionality
  • No breaking changes: The removal doesn't affect any shared dependencies or core infrastructure

Performance & Security

  • Reduced repository size: Removes 420 lines of code, reducing repo bloat
  • No security concerns: The removal doesn't introduce any security issues
  • Clean dependency cleanup: The removal includes the requirements.txt file, avoiding unused dependencies

Test Coverage

  • No test impact: As this was an example integration, no core tests are affected
  • Documentation consistency: README remains accurate and up-to-date

Summary

This PR represents a clean, thorough removal of the Portia integration example. The author has:

  • Removed all associated files completely
  • Updated documentation appropriately
  • Maintained repository structure and consistency
  • Provided a clear commit message and PR description

Recommendation: ✅ Approve - This is a well-executed cleanup with no issues identified.


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ant